Usage guidelines
The payload scrambling setting must be the same at both ends of a link.
Payload scrambling enables an interface to scramble outgoing data and unscramble incoming data.
This feature prevents the presence of long strings of all 1s or all 0s.
Several physical layer protocols rely on transitions between 1s and 0s to maintain clocking. Payload
scrambling enables the receiving end to extract the line clock signal correctly.
If payload scrambling is disabled, the interface does not scramble outgoing data or unscramble
incoming data.
Examples
# Enable payload scrambling on POS 2/2/0.
<Sysname> system-view
[Sysname] interface pos 2/2/0
[Sysname-Pos2/2/0]scramble
